logo

Output 8aab70173343780a1595e7128c3f92a38ef91706f9750f49e983f62468cd07e9:0

value
54959000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 58bd130b60301ec5b780f76091c46629d8a3a692 OP_EQUALVERIFY OP_CHECKSIG
address
196Cy11ZEFtRtysrnP6hYPXo147vgMRruR
transaction
8aab70173343780a1595e7128c3f92a38ef91706f9750f49e983f62468cd07e9